如何在MATLAB环境下利用牛顿拉夫逊法进行电力系统潮流计算?请结合极坐标系详细说明计算步骤。
时间: 2024-11-10 20:24:36 浏览: 35
在MATLAB环境下进行电力系统的潮流计算,尤其是采用牛顿拉夫逊法结合极坐标系,是电力工程领域常见的项目实战应用。首先,你需要构建电力系统的导纳矩阵,这是整个计算过程的基础。然后,定义初始电压幅值和相角,这些通常设为1.0 p.u.和0度。接下来,进行迭代计算,每次迭代包括以下步骤:(步骤、代码、mermaid流程图、扩展内容,此处略)
参考资源链接:[牛顿拉夫逊极坐标法在电力系统潮流计算中的应用](https://wenku.csdn.net/doc/1vsuccs2jv?spm=1055.2569.3001.10343)
步骤1:计算功率不平衡量。使用牛顿-拉夫逊方法计算系统的功率不平衡量,即实际功率和理论功率之间的差值。
步骤2:构建雅可比矩阵。基于极坐标系下的潮流方程,计算雅可比矩阵。
步骤3:求解修正方程。利用高斯消元法或LU分解法求解线性方程组,得到电压幅值和相角的修正量。
步骤4:更新电压幅值和相角。根据修正量更新电压幅值和相角,并检查收敛性。如果未收敛,则返回步骤1继续迭代。
步骤5:潮流计算完成后,进行结果分析。分析电压稳定性、潮流分布、过载情况等,确保系统的稳定性和经济性。
通过上述步骤,可以在MATLAB环境下利用牛顿拉夫逊法结合极坐标系进行潮流计算。为了深入理解该计算过程,建议参阅《牛顿拉夫逊极坐标法在电力系统潮流计算中的应用》一书,该书详细介绍了基于极坐标的牛顿拉夫逊方法在电力系统潮流计算中的应用,将帮助你更好地掌握潮流计算的理论与实践技巧。
参考资源链接:[牛顿拉夫逊极坐标法在电力系统潮流计算中的应用](https://wenku.csdn.net/doc/1vsuccs2jv?spm=1055.2569.3001.10343)
阅读全文